3. Description:

Oracle Java SE version 7 includes the Oracle Java Runtime Environment and
the Oracle Java Software Development Kit.

This update fixes two vulnerabilities in the Oracle Java Runtime
Environment and the Oracle Java Software Development Kit. Further
information about these flaws can be found on the Oracle Security Alert
page, listed in the References section. (CVE-2012-3174, CVE-2013-0422)

Red Hat is aware that a public exploit for CVE-2013-0422 is available that
executes code without user interaction when a user visits a malicious web
page using a browser with the Oracle Java 7 web browser plug-in enabled.

All users of java-1.7.0-oracle are advised to upgrade to these updated
packages, which provide Oracle Java 7 Update 11 and resolve these issues.
All running instances of Oracle Java must be restarted for the update to
take effect.
